Brightness Sync
Brightness Sync is a utility designed to synchronize the brightness levels of LG UltraFine displays with the built-in display of a Mac. It automatically adjusts the external monitor's brightness to match the Mac's display, making it ideal for users with multiple monitors, especially LG UltraFine models.
Synchronizes brightness between LG UltraFine displays and the Mac's built-in display.

Displays
Displays is a comprehensive tool for managing monitor resolution and settings, particularly useful for users with multiple monitors or those needing precise adjustments. Its unique features include advanced settings management and an intuitive user interface.
Displays allows users to manage monitor resolution and settings effectively.
